What's new in Data Visualization 7.0.0

Cloudera Data Visualization (CDV) 7.0.0 was released on May 17, 2022 introducing the following changes.

New features and improvements in Cloudera Data Visualization 7.0.0

VIZ-20
Some major updates have been made to the Bootstrap and jQuery libraries. Bootstrap was upgraded from 3.3.7 to 4.6.0 and jQuery was upgraded from 2.2.4 to 3.6.0. This change has a potential impact to customers who have created Custom Styles in earlier versions of CDV, since they would potentially contain code that references legacy Bootstrap classes or jQuery methods in their CSS and/or JS respectively. For more information, see the Custom Styles Migration Guide.
VIZ-1115 & VIZ-1217
You can query your data directly through a new SQL tab in the top navigation bar, and a new homepage layout has been introduced so you can quickly add and access recent queries, data connections, and datasets alongside their dashboards and applications. From the SQL tab, you can now create a new dataset or dashboard from a query with a single click. Additionally, when editing a dashboard, updating a SQL-based dataset is even easier with the new Edit Dataset SQL option from the in-visual options menu.
VIZ-1328
[Tech Preview] Data Extracts are now available as a technical preview feature. Data Extracts help with managing the analytical capabilities, performance, concurrency, and security of data access across data connections. For more information, contact your Cloudera representative.

Fixed issues in Cloudera Data Visualization 7.0.0

VIZ-1220
Fixed a bug where a dashboard could become uneditable after disabling Custom Styles.
VIZ-1270
Fixed a bug where roles were not deletable from the Manage Roles interface.
VIZ-1313
Additional bug fixes and usability improvements.
VIZ-1333
Dashboards now appear in a searchable list in the Set Homepage interface.
VIZ-1339
Show/Hide Password toggles in the Change My Password modal now work as expected.
VIZ-1367
Visuals without a secondary axis should no longer display settings options for the secondary axis.
